An open-source database to hold customer data, but its performance should be improved
Firebird SQL significantly improved our data management in many parts of our self-developed ERP system. I rate the solution's performance and speed a six out of ten. Two or three database administrators are needed to maintain the solution. A few years ago, migrating data to or from Firebird SQL was a little bit difficult because the identifier names for tables or stored procedures were limited to 20 to 30 characters. Transferring the structure to Firebird SQL was difficult, but they fixed it in version 3, which was much easier. We are developing software with Delphi, and Delphi is also by Embarcadero. Using InterBase or Firebird SQL databases is very common, and you have some good tools for developing with Firebird SQL. Overall, I rate the solution a seven out of ten.

Open-source and free to use with a good community
I would love to see the flashback in Percona MySQL or even in Percona PostgreSQL. It's available in Oracle, the flashback. In Oracle, there's the utility of a flashback. It stores all the information in the tables for a few days. That way, if I accidentally delete my records from the table or I need to check the value of a column or row two days back, I can. If Percona had flashback capabilities, it would be ideal. I would love to see training be easier to find. I had some complications finding the training that Percona provides. It is not displayed on the website. For example, if I want to train myself via a Percona expert through virtual files or through recorded videos or something like that, it's really difficult to find any sort of course. You have to email them first, and they will ask you whether it is for yourself or it is for the corporate sector. The course content should just be readily available and not hidden.
